Tonja Machulla is a leading researcher in the field of human-computer interaction, with a particular focus on mid-air ultrasound haptics and virtual reality. Her work addresses a critical challenge in VR: enabling tactile feedback without requiring users to wear gloves or hold controllers. In her most-cited paper, "Extended Mid-air Ultrasound Haptics for Virtual Reality" (2022, 16 citations), Machulla introduced a novel approach that transforms a static haptic array into a dynamic one, following the user’s movements to deliver room-scale tactile sensations. This breakthrough expands the limited workspace of traditional mid-air haptics, making it viable for immersive, large-scale VR environments. Her contributions bridge the gap between physical touch and digital interaction, enhancing realism in virtual experiences.
